Marketing
Equally practical and theoretical, this major incorporates the development and implementation of marketing plans and advertising campaigns, as well as conducting and interpreting market research.
You’ll explore areas such as consumer behaviour, promotion, advertising, market research, project and channel management and strategic marketing. Practical projects may include developing marketing plans, implementing advertising campaigns, or conducting marketing research and developing marketing strategies. This major involves comprehensive study with some of the best marketing academics and professionals in the country. It is taught through a combination of lectures, tutorials, workshops and other in-class activities. Combined with the Business School’s high-level industry partnerships, it balances theory, practice and future prospects for students looking for a career in marketing.
EMPLOYMENT OPPORTUNITY
A major in Marketing leads to careers in areas such as marketing management, advertising, sales management, digital marketing, distribution control, product development and branding, new venture creation and marketing research or consulting. You can find employment in all industry sectors including not-for-profit, private and public organisations.
PROFESSIONAL RECOGNITION
Business School’s the only one in WA accredited by the European Quality Improvement System (EQUIS) and the Association to Advance Collegiate Schools of Business (AACSB).
